Through real-life stories, the full-colour, 256-page
Changing Our World: True Stories of Women Engineers
celebrates the contributions of women engineers to every aspect of modern life. It explores the lives and careers of hundreds of women engineers of all ages and backgrounds - extraordinary women who serve as role models to tell the untold story of engineering. These inspirational stories will give you a fresh perspective on engineering. As a fundamental resource for educational outreach programs,
Changing Our World
offers young women inspiration and encouragement to pursue careers in engineering. When placed in school libraries and counseling centers, the book provides girls and their parents with an exciting exploration into what is possible. Publication of
Changing Our World
represents a significant milestone for the Extraordinary Women Engineers Project - a collaborative effort of many different individuals and organizations to address the long-standing underrepresentation of women in the engineering profession.
